Palm Island



This is Palm Island, an engineering masterpiece, captured from space by the IKONOS satellite. This is one of three large artificial islands being built off the coast of the United Arab Emirates. This one is almost completed. The purpose? To make this the biggest tourism attraction in the world. Hmm ... tourism .. in the Middle East.

First Successful Permanent Photograph



It may not look like much, but it took a full day exposure to accomplish this back in 1826. It was taken by Nicéphore Niépce. Read more at Wikipedia.

Big Hole



I just found about this via reddit.com. It's a big hole in Russia -- a diamond mine apparently, in Eastern Siberia, near the town of Mirna. It's about half a kilometre deep and one and a quarter in diameter. It's interesting -- in a horrifying kinda way.

The Universe in a Year

What if the entire 14 billion years of the universe's existence was compressed down to 1 year? Not surprisingly, everything we care about would only happen in a few minutes on the last day of this cosmic year.
